Cayce council approves FY27 State Victim Assistance Grant participation and fills Events Committee vacancies
Summary
Council unanimously approved the city's participation in the FY27 State Victim Assistance Grant, entered committee minutes into the record, and appointed two members to the Events Committee; motions passed by roll call votes.

At the April 22 meeting the Cayce City Council approved a financial participation agreement for the FY27 State Victim Assistance Grant after a motion by Council Member Byron Thomas and a second from Council Member Alice Rose; the approval passed unanimously by roll call vote.
Council also voted to enter the Cayce Historical Museum Commission minutes (March 4, 2026) into the city's record on a motion from Mayor Pro Tem Phil Carter, and appointed Felicia Thomas and Vanessa Mota to two open positions on the Events Committee after a motion by Council Member Byron Thomas and a second by Council Member Tiffany Aull. Both motions passed unanimously by roll call vote.
City Manager Michael Conley summarized upcoming community events announced to the council, including the Cayce Public Safety Foundation Chicken Bog fundraiser (April 23), the Women's Club Hot Flash 5K (May 2), and an Employee Appreciation Luncheon (May 13). Council Member Byron Thomas encouraged participation in community cleanups and noted ongoing work on a potential golf cart ordinance, coordinated with neighboring West Columbia as a possible model.
